The light cruiser "Noshiro" was built in September 1941, just before the war started, as the second ship of the Agano class, and was completed in June 1943, in the middle of the war. While other ships of the same type were built at the Sasebo Naval Arsenal, the Noshiro was built at the Yokosuka Naval Arsenal. The previous class of the Agano type was the Kawauchi type, and there was an interval of 20 years between the Agano and the Kawauchi type, so the Agano became a ship with a modern aspect. With a standard displacement of 6,652 tons and an overall length of 172 meters, the larger ship was equipped with three 15 cm twin guns and two newly developed 8 cm long twin high-angle guns as main guns. Immediately after her completion, Noshiro became the flagship of the 2nd Mine Squadron and engaged in transport and escort operations in the Central Pacific. In June 1944, she participated in the Battle of Mariana. Before and after this battle, her armament was reinforced, including additional equipment such as machine guns and some electric radars. In October 1944, she accompanied the main forces of the Yamato and Musashi in Operation Sho Ichi I (Battle of Leyte). In an encounter with a U.S. escort carrier, she was hit by a direct hit and had to retreat, but was hit by lightning in an air attack and died in the battle. The product can reproduce the appearance at the time of the Battle of Leyte in October 1944, the final form. The figure is additionally equipped with a No. 21 electric search equipped from the time of completion, two No. 22 electric search, and No. 13 electric search. Equipped with 18 units of 25mm single armored machine gun, 10 units of 25mm machine gun with a gun seat installed in the stern. The Type 96 25mm machine gun (triple-armored and single armored) can be selected from two types of quality parts. The gun barrel and mount are separate parts for precision and easy painting. The base is molded in gray and the barrel in gunmetal, allowing for color separation without painting. The runners of the base and gun barrel are designed to be combined to fit in the adhesive position, and gate-cut after using pour-in adhesive. The three machine guns have separate bulletproof plates, allowing for even more precise construction. The other type is the conventional one-piece molded type. The shape of the modern Agano type, which is different from the trend of Japanese light cruisers up to that time, is reproduced in its entirety. The body of the ship is a left-right laminated type, and the detailed modeling of the port side is reproduced. The outer electrical lines that run around the entire perimeter of the port side are delicately sculpted, even the clasps are represented. The deck and bridge layers are sculpted to reproduce the linoleum fittings and the anti-slip and strip patterns of the steel deck. The bridge forward shelter is an integral part using a slide mold. The side walls are sculpted and shaped with precision. The main gun turret is a slide mold with windows, lattice and steel plate joints on the side and top surfaces. The chimney top grating is sculpted realistically in a loose state, and the internal rectification plate is also sculpted as a separate part. The chimney is laminated on both sides, and the monkey rattal is sculpted. Steam dumping pipes are separately sculpted as separate parts to show the difference from the sister ships. The triangular pyramidal truss at the bottom of the mast has been removed using a slide mold. The small cranes on both sides of the aft end of the aviation work deck are reproduced accurately and three-dimensionally as separate parts. The 4.5 meter high angle rangefinder has been accurately reproduced with its cylindrical arms and is included as a dedicated part. The No. 22 electric probe, port ladder (retracted), azimuth antenna, and auxiliary wing storage are all included as separate parts. The 8cm long anti-aircraft gun is included as a specially designed part with separate parts for the shield and barrel. The water reconnaissance crane has been reproduced up to the light hole on the side to increase the sense of precision. Two Type Zero (three-seater) water reconnaissance aircraft are included. Molding color is gray. Two types of decals are included. Two types of decals are included in the kit, one for the flag of the warship and the other for the Nissho flag. Three sizes are available for the flag of warships. Included are 1/700 scale versions of the actual 10-width, 6-width, and 3-width flags. Included are the sunburst and the identification band (yellow band) of the ship's aircraft, including the sunburst without the white border from the later stages of World War II. The decals include the draft, the chrysanthemum crest on the bow, and the name of the ship on the stern (in gold or filled-in warship colors). The Noshiro's distinctive parts have been exclusively designed. The porthole has parts to reproduce the reduced porthole compared to the Agano. The sighting hand window on the front of the main gun turret is not enlarged, and parts for No.1 to No.3 ships are included. The shape of the air working deck, including the openings, is provided with special parts. The chimney and steam dumping pipe are dedicated parts to reproduce the differences between the individual ships. The anti-aircraft gun emplacement is shaped in an angular form, which is different from the Agano and Noshiro. The paravane next to the first turret and the air intake structure next to the torpedo tubes are exclusively prepared in square shape. The front of the Rashin bridge has no blue work compared to the Agano. Molded parts come in three colors: gray, transparent, and gun metallic, which mimic the Kure Arsenal colors. 200 parts to assemble.
